matrimony, n. [marriage], wedlock.
matron, n. dame.
matronly, a. elderly, [dignified], matronal.
matted, a. [tangled], snarled, entangled.
matter, n. substance, [material], [body]; essence, [pith], embodiment, elements; [importance], [significance], [moment], [consequence], [weight], [materiality]; [pus], purulence; [manuscript], [copy]. Associated words: [material], immaterial, [materiality], immateriality, [atom], [molecule], chemistry, hylism, hylotheism, hylopathism, hylogenesis, materialism, physics, somatics, somatology.
matter, v. import, [signify], be of [importance]; [maturate], suppurate.
matter-of-fact, a. [practical], pragmatical, [unimaginative], [commonplace], prosaic.
maturate, v. suppurate; [mature].
maturation, n. suppuration; maturing.
mature, a. full-grown, [ripe], developed, [perfect]; prepared, finished. Antonyms: See immature.
